Vancouver Police are investigating after a senior was attacked, allegedly with a hammer, in his suite in a West End apartment.
It happened just after 4 p.m. in Sunset Towers at 1655 Barclay Street. The victim suffered a severe head injury, but according to police he is in stable condition.

Another person who lived in the building was arrested by police and remains in custody.
According to Mark Haggerty, a resident of the building, the victim was hit in the head by a hammer and police used a taser on the suspect.

Haggerty added that the victim is a quiet man who had lived in the building for several years, but is well-liked by other residents.
Vancouver Police say an investigation into the incident has begun.
